wall pepper
Meaning, Definition & Usage
Dictionary
Related
noun
mossy European creeping sedum with yellow flowers; widely introduced as a ground cover
Sedum acre
.
WordNet
Previous
walkman
walkout
walkover
walkway
walkyr
Next
walla walla
wallaba
wallaby
wallace
wallah